We were there February last year over half term, 10th-24th. It was very hot (far hotter than my previous February trips), and very busy. However, despite that it was manageable with fastpass use and planning, we didn’t have any excessive waits. There were a few times it felt very crowded though, particularly in MK and AK.

Having said that, I would still happily go again at that time of year.

We went Feb half term a few years ago. Weather was variable - some chilly days, some very warm days and a couple of days quite hot. We needed jackets in the evenings, but overall we found the weather was much more pleasant than in the summer months.

It was busy around Presidents Day, but as previous posters have said, with FastPass use it wasn’t bad. The second week we stayed a couple of nights at Universals Hard Rock to get the Express Passes and early entry. We didn’t need these though as Universal was really quiet.

Overall we thought it was a great time of year to go.
